New Jersey Gov. Chris Christie (R) was paid a visit by former basketball superstar Shaquille O'Neal on Friday.
According to the Daily Record, Shaq visited Christie's office to discuss getting involved in New Jersey's gun buyback program.
Christie told the Daily Record that Shaq, a Newark, N.J., native and co-owner of a theater in the city, has some "good ideas."
“We’ll do something with him," the governor said.
